Adverse possession, also known as title by prescription or prescriptive title, is a legal doctrine that allows a person to gain legal ownership of real estate if they possess it for a certain period of time and meet other legal requirements.

Replevin, also known as claim and delivery, is the legal action of recovering personal property which was wrongfully taken.

To establish a claim of title to real property by adverse possession, a party must demonstrate, by clear and convincing evidence, that the possession was (1) hostile and under claim of right, (2) actual, (3) open and notorious, (4) exclusive, and (5) continuous for the statutory period of 10 years.

Replevin is the common law cause of action for recovering personal property wrongfully withheld from its rightful owner. This is more commonly associated with personal chattels.
